Raised garden beds along a fence can be a beautiful and practical addition to any outdoor space. By utilizing vertical space and maximizing exposure to sunlight, these beds can provide a productive and visually appealing garden area.

One of the main benefits of raised garden beds along a fence is that they can help save space in smaller yards or gardens. By using the fence as a support for climbing plants such as tomatoes, cucumbers, or beans, you can make the most of limited space and create a lush and abundant garden.

In addition to saving space, raised garden beds along a fence can also help protect plants from pests and other threats. By elevating the soil, you can prevent weeds from spreading and make it more difficult for animals such as rabbits or deer to access your plants. This can result in healthier and more productive crops.

Raised garden beds along a fence are also easier to maintain and care for. With the soil contained in a designated area, you can more easily control watering, fertilizing, and weeding. This can result in a more organized and efficient gardening experience, with less time spent on maintenance and more time enjoying your garden.

Furthermore, raised garden beds can help improve drainage and prevent waterlogging, which can be particularly beneficial in rainy climates. By elevating the soil, excess water can drain more easily and help prevent plants from becoming waterlogged and prone to diseases such as root rot.

Overall, raised garden beds along a fence can be a versatile and practical addition to any garden. Whether you are looking to save space, improve drainage, or simply create a visually appealing garden area, raised beds along a fence can offer a solution that is both functional and aesthetically pleasing. With proper planning and care, a garden along a fence can be a beautiful and productive addition to your outdoor space.
